Why did KPMG dump Phil?

KPMG's U.S. firm has severed its longtime relationship with champion golfer Phil Mickelson after he was quoted making comments about the PGA Tour, a rival golf league sponsored by Saudi Arabia, and slain journalist Jamal Khashoggi.

How long has KPMG sponsor Phil Mickelson?

Mickelson has been sponsored by KPMG since 2008 and has worn the company's logo on his cap and visor all the way up until early 2022. “KPMG U.S. and Phil Mickelson have mutually agreed to end our sponsorship effective immediately.

What is KPMG known for?

KPMG is a multinational accounting and auditing firm, providing three main business services - audit, advisory and tax services. The name KPMG represents the four principle founding members of the company and their respective member firms - Piet Klynveld, William Barclay Peat, James Marwick, and Reinhard Goerdeler.

Is KPMG a big 4?

The "Big Four" is the nickname used to refer to the four largest accounting firms in the United States, as measured by revenue. They are Deloitte, Ernst & Young (EY), PricewaterhouseCoopers (PwC), and Klynveld Peat Marwick Goerdeler (KPMG).
